SHINee's Key posted the music video for "Another Life," a track from his upcoming full-length album "Gasoline," on Friday on social media.
 
According to SM Entertainment, "Another Life" is an electronic-pop track with a strong synth sound. The lyrics are about wanting to go to a different dimension to chase eternal love.
 
"Gasoline" has 11 tracks, including the title track and "Another Life." The album will drop on Aug. 30.
 
Before the album is released, Key will perform at "SMTown Live 2022: SMCU Express @Tokyo," a joint concert by SM Entertainment artists. It will be held at the Tokyo Dome from Aug. 27 to 29.
 
Key debuted in 2008 as a member of SHINee, a boy band best known for songs “Ring Ding Dong” (2009), “Lucifer” (2010) and “Sherlock (Clue + Note)” (2012). SHINee currently has four members: Tae-min, Min-ho, Key and Onew.
 
Key released his first solo music in 2018 with the single "Forever Yours." He released his first full-length album "Face" in the same year. His last release was the EP "Bad Love" (2021).
